Proto-Coracholan *'átsi "bat".
Attestations:
- Wixárika 'átsi
- Náayeri
- Chuistestyaka: átsi'i "murciélago" (Muñíz 2024:13); játzi'i "murciélago, bat" Pl. játzi'ise
- Kuáxa'taana: átsi's "murciélago" (Muñíz 2024:13)
- Proposal 1. This root may come from a PSUA root *patsi, which weakened /p/ to Proto-Corachol-Nahua /h/ hatsí and then /ʔ/, giving 'átsi.
- Proposal 2: This root may come from Proto-Corachol-Nahuan *tsoi "bat" with an added prefix, ʔa-/ha of unknown meaning.
